diff options
author | Joel Sherrill <joel.sherrill@OARcorp.com> | 2005-04-28 16:17:39 +0000 |
---|---|---|
committer | Joel Sherrill <joel.sherrill@OARcorp.com> | 2005-04-28 16:17:39 +0000 |
commit | 27d619b86bd3ea6a36c8d3258ac6cba06b22a6e6 (patch) | |
tree | 676f2c9228a668ad9e8cdebc4fc10866204459da /c/src/lib/libbsp/powerpc/dmv177/include/bsp.h | |
parent | 2005-04-28 Jennifer Averett <jennifer.averett@oarcorp.com> (diff) | |
download | rtems-27d619b86bd3ea6a36c8d3258ac6cba06b22a6e6.tar.bz2 |
2005-04-28 Joel Sherrill <joel@OARcorp.com>
* acinclude.m4: Remove dmv177 and ppcn_60x.
* dmv177/.cvsignore, dmv177/ChangeLog, dmv177/Makefile.am,
dmv177/QUIRKS, dmv177/README, dmv177/README.net, dmv177/STATUS,
dmv177/bsp_specs, dmv177/cable.doc, dmv177/configure.ac,
dmv177/times, dmv177/clock/clock.c, dmv177/console/conscfg.c,
dmv177/console/debugio.c, dmv177/include/.cvsignore,
dmv177/include/bsp.h, dmv177/include/dmv170.h, dmv177/include/tm27.h,
dmv177/scv64/scv64.c, dmv177/sonic/dmvsonic.c, dmv177/start/start.S,
dmv177/startup/bspclean.c, dmv177/startup/bspstart.c,
dmv177/startup/genpvec.c, dmv177/startup/linkcmds,
dmv177/startup/setvec.c, dmv177/startup/vmeintr.c,
dmv177/timer/timer.c, dmv177/tod/todcfg.c, ppcn_60x/.cvsignore,
ppcn_60x/ChangeLog, ppcn_60x/Makefile.am, ppcn_60x/README,
ppcn_60x/STATUS, ppcn_60x/bsp_specs, ppcn_60x/configure.ac,
ppcn_60x/clock/clock.c, ppcn_60x/console/config.c,
ppcn_60x/console/console.c, ppcn_60x/console/console.h,
ppcn_60x/console/debugio.c, ppcn_60x/console/i8042.c,
ppcn_60x/console/i8042_p.h, ppcn_60x/console/i8042vga.c,
ppcn_60x/console/i8042vga.h, ppcn_60x/console/ns16550cfg.c,
ppcn_60x/console/ns16550cfg.h, ppcn_60x/console/vga.c,
ppcn_60x/console/vga_p.h, ppcn_60x/console/z85c30cfg.c,
ppcn_60x/console/z85c30cfg.h, ppcn_60x/include/.cvsignore,
ppcn_60x/include/bsp.h, ppcn_60x/include/extisrdrv.h,
ppcn_60x/include/nvram.h, ppcn_60x/include/pci.h,
ppcn_60x/include/tm27.h, ppcn_60x/network/amd79c970.c,
ppcn_60x/network/amd79c970.h, ppcn_60x/nvram/ds1385.h,
ppcn_60x/nvram/mk48t18.h, ppcn_60x/nvram/nvram.c,
ppcn_60x/nvram/prepnvr.h, ppcn_60x/nvram/stk11c68.h,
ppcn_60x/pci/pci.c, ppcn_60x/start/start.S,
ppcn_60x/startup/bspclean.c, ppcn_60x/startup/bspstart.c,
ppcn_60x/startup/bsptrap.S, ppcn_60x/startup/genpvec.c,
ppcn_60x/startup/linkcmds, ppcn_60x/startup/rtems-ctor.cc,
ppcn_60x/startup/setvec.c, ppcn_60x/startup/spurious.c,
ppcn_60x/startup/swap.c, ppcn_60x/timer/timer.c, ppcn_60x/tod/cmos.h,
ppcn_60x/tod/tod.c, ppcn_60x/universe/universe.c,
ppcn_60x/vectors/README, ppcn_60x/vectors/align_h.S,
ppcn_60x/vectors/vectors.S: Removed.
Diffstat (limited to '')
-rw-r--r-- | c/src/lib/libbsp/powerpc/dmv177/include/bsp.h | 150 |
1 files changed, 0 insertions, 150 deletions
diff --git a/c/src/lib/libbsp/powerpc/dmv177/include/bsp.h b/c/src/lib/libbsp/powerpc/dmv177/include/bsp.h deleted file mode 100644 index 21cfc26dd5..0000000000 --- a/c/src/lib/libbsp/powerpc/dmv177/include/bsp.h +++ /dev/null @@ -1,150 +0,0 @@ -/* bsp.h - * - * This include file contains all DY-4 DMV170 board IO definitions. - * - * COPYRIGHT (c) 1989-1997. - * On-Line Applications Research Corporation (OAR). - * - * $Id$ - */ - -#ifndef __DMV170_BSP_h -#define __DMV170_BSP_h - -#ifdef __cplusplus -extern "C" { -#endif - -#include <bspopts.h> - -/* - * confdefs.h overrides for this BSP: - * - termios serial ports (defaults to 1) - * - Interrupt stack space is not minimum if defined. - */ - -#define CONFIGURE_NUMBER_OF_TERMIOS_PORTS 4 -#define CONFIGURE_INTERRUPT_STACK_MEMORY (12 * 1024) - -#ifdef ASM -/* Definition of where to store registers in alignment handler */ -#define ALIGN_REGS 0x0140 - -#else -#include <rtems.h> -#include <rtems/console.h> -#include <rtems/clockdrv.h> -#include <rtems/console.h> -#include <rtems/iosupp.h> - -#include <dmv170.h> - -#if 0 -#define Enable_Debug() \ - DMV170_WRITE( 0xffffbd0c, 0 ) - -#define Debug_Entry( num ) \ - DMV170_WRITE( 0xffffbd06, num ) -#else -#define Enable_Debug() -#define Debug_Entry( num ) -#endif - -/* - * Network driver configuration - */ -struct rtems_bsdnet_ifconfig; -int rtems_dmv177_sonic_driver_attach(struct rtems_bsdnet_ifconfig *config); -#define RTEMS_BSP_NETWORK_DRIVER_NAME "sonic1" -#define RTEMS_BSP_NETWORK_DRIVER_ATTACH rtems_dmv177_sonic_driver_attach - -/* - * The following macro calculates the Baud constant. For the Z8530 chip. - */ -#define Z8530_Baud( _frequency, _clock_by, _baud_rate ) \ - ( (_frequency /( _clock_by * 2 * _baud_rate)) - 2) - -/* Constants */ - -/* - * Device Driver Table Entries - */ - -/* - * NOTE: Use the standard Console driver entry - */ - -/* - * NOTE: Use the standard Clock driver entry - */ - -/* - * Information placed in the linkcmds file. - */ - -extern int RAM_START; -extern int RAM_END; -extern int RAM_SIZE; - -extern int PROM_START; -extern int PROM_END; -extern int PROM_SIZE; - -extern int CLOCK_SPEED; - -extern int end; /* last address in the program */ - -/* - * How many libio files we want - */ - -#define BSP_LIBIO_MAX_FDS 20 - -/* functions */ - -/* - * genvec.c - */ -rtems_isr_entry set_EE_vector( - rtems_isr_entry handler, /* isr routine */ - rtems_vector_number vector /* vector number */ -); -void initialize_external_exception_vector (); - -/* - * console.c - */ -void DEBUG_puts( char *string ); - -void BSP_fatal_return( void ); - -void bsp_start( void ); - -void bsp_cleanup( void ); - -rtems_isr_entry set_vector( /* returns old vector */ - rtems_isr_entry handler, /* isr routine */ - rtems_vector_number vector, /* vector number */ - int type /* RTEMS or RAW intr */ -); - -void BSP_fatal_return( void ); - -void bsp_spurious_initialize( void ); - -extern rtems_configuration_table BSP_Configuration; /* owned by BSP */ - -extern rtems_cpu_table Cpu_table; /* owned by BSP */ - -extern uint32_t bsp_isr_level; - -extern int CPU_PPC_CLICKS_PER_MS; - -#endif /* ASM */ - -#ifdef __cplusplus -} -#endif - -#endif -/* end of include file */ |